What is 1x2 Predictions?

1X2 predictions is simply the outcome of a fixture and is often referred to as match result. The 1X2 connects straightforwardly to this: backing the home team, which is signified by the number 1, backing the draw, which is signified by the letter X, backing the away team, which is signified by the number 2.

Dortmund, in their search for reinforcements, turn to Bellingham junior

At Borussia Dortmund, they have fond memories of Jude Bellingham. So fond, in fact, that the name Bellingham features high on their wishlist as they look to strengthen the squad for the new season. Jobe Bellingham, to be precise the younger brother of the Real Madrid superstar.

Champions League will have a special winner this season no matter what

The Champions League final this year will be between Internazionale and Paris Saint-Germain, and that’s quite remarkable. For example, it means that for the first time in a long while, the billion-euro tournament will not have a winner from England, Spain, or Germany.

Bordeaux has 436 creditors: clubs, the tax authorities, and the local baker

The exact scale of Girondins de Bordeaux’s debt has come to light through various French media outlets. The fallen giant owes a total of 94 million euros to 436 creditors, and the list of parties is remarkably diverse. Just about everyone is still owed money by Bordeaux even the local baker.
